§ 77-4-211 — Amortization Of Investment
77-4-211 . Amortization of investment.
(1)In all cases where the lease or license issued by the United States requires the amortization of the investment made in dams, machinery, equipment, and appurtenant works, such amortization requirement shall also apply to that portion of the investment representing the state's part or share in the power site so that the state will at all times retain its full share of ownership in the power site and in the dams, machinery, equipment, and appurtenant works.
